Taxonomical Classification
This plant belongs to the kingdom Plantae and the phylum Streptophyta, falling under the class Equisetopsida and subclass Magnoliidae. Within the order Ranunculales, it is classified under the family Papaveraceae. Finally, Corydalis saxicola is categorized under the genus Corydalis.

Distribution
This plant, known as Corydalis saxicola, exhibits a specific distribution pattern across several regions of China. It can be found growing within the diverse landscapes of China South-Central. Additionally, the species is documented to inhabit areas throughout China North-Central. Its presence also extends into the territories of China Southeast. These findings highlight the widespread yet localized occurrence of the species across the country.

Morphology
The morphology of Corydalis saxicola is characterized by its growth form as a non-woody herb. As a forb, the plant is entirely non-woody in structure and functions as a self-supporting organism rather than a climber. In terms of stature, it typically reaches a mean plant height of 0.35 m, with individual specimens ranging from a minimum height of 0.3 m to a maximum height of 0.4 m.

Reproduction
The reproduction of Corydalis saxicola is characterized by the development of distinct inflorescences and fruit structures that follow specific morphological dimensions. The inflorescence length varies across the population, with measurements ranging from a minimum of 0.07 m to a maximum of 0.15 m. Following successful pollination, the plant produces fruits that exhibit high morphological consistency; the fruit length is measured at a constant 2.5 cm, representing both the minimum, mean, and maximum values recorded for this species.

Chemicals
Corydalis saxicola has 7 reported phytochemicals identified across 7 scientific publications and several other databases. The most consistently reported chemicals include dehydrocavidine, Coptisine, Dehydroapocavidine, tetradehydroscoulerine, Demethylsonodione.
